History

I made my first YouTube account, GangstaSkoodge, on June 5, 2006. 6 months later, I discovered the poops of dvariano, SuperYoshi, RetroJape, tetsuo9999, 1upclock, etc. I was very interested in these videos, and favorited as much as I could find. However, it never occured to me to make my own. 2 years passed, and I made a new account to distance myself from my old name. At the time, I was drawing and creating my own cartoon characters. One that popped out was a snakelike alien I called Mike Owub (his last name being a phonetic anagram of boa). Unable to come up with any clever title, I shortened the name and titled my new account Mowub. 3 years later, in February 2011, SpAmStIkA suggested that I join YouChew, and that I could find video editing software there. Being a Mac user, I joined, downloaded Final Cut Pro, and made some very primitive pieces out of stuff like Aaahh!!! Real Monsters, The Ant and the Aardvark, Space Ghost Coast to Coast, and Mystery Science Theater 3000. It wasn't until that summer that I discovered the art of stutters, repetition, and pitch shifting, previously thinking it to be a bad poopism. With Cortes as an inspiration, I went crazy with it. Somewhere, along the way, I discovered a strange and incredibly rare cartoon from the makers of Real Monsters called Santo Bugito. After having some initial doubts, I tried pooping the only episode that was available, mainly because I wanted to be different and poop stuff that nobody else had touched. In December, Simon Belmont Painting, as a Christmas gift, sent me DVD rips of all 13 episodes, which I later uploaded to my alt. Since then, I've improved in some ways and have changed my style a bit.
